H&R 1871
H&R Inc., builders of the Harrington & Richardson and New England Firearms brands, offers a strong line of long guns.
The H&R Tamer is a short-barreled .410 snake gun that has some interesting features. The high-impact synthetic stock has a thumbhole design with a full pistol grip. A recess in the side of the stock holds four shells of .410. It has H&R's single-shot action with a transfer bar safety. The barrel is 19 1/2 inches long, the chamber will handle 3-inch shotshells and it's fully choked. It weighs 6 pounds.
The Handi-Rifles from New England Firearms are classic single-shots that are becoming a favorite with shooters. Calibers range from .22 Hornet to the .45-70 Govt. They have adjustable rear sights or can be outfitted with scope mounts. Shooters can also select a standard or Monte Carlo stock and forend of walnut-stained hardwood. The newest addition to the Handi-Rifle line-up is a bull-barrel varmint version.
New England Firearms also builds a National Wild Turkey Federation-sponsored shotgun. The 10-gauge model has a 24-inch barrel with 3 1/2-inch chamber and turkey full choke. The 20-gauge youth version has a 22-inch barrel, 3-inch chamber and modified choke. Both guns have rubber recoil pads and are dressed completely in Mossy Oak camouflage.
Interarms
The Rossi lever-action will have shooters thinking of the Old West. The Model 92SRC is chambered in .38 Special and .357 Magnum. It holds 10 rounds, has a 20-inch barrel, is 37 inches long overall and weighs 6 pounds. The shorter and lighter Model 92SRS, also in .38 Special and .357 Magnum, holds eight rounds, has a 16-inch barrel, is 33 inches long overall and weighs 5 3/4 pounds. The .44 Magnum version, the Model 65SRC, is nearly identical to the Model 92SRC.
Long-time Rossi favorites are the .22 caliber pump-action gallery firearms. They are truly fun-to-shoot guns. Options include an octagon barrel, blued and nickel finishes, and rifle or carbine configurations.
For those who have been delaying the purchase of a Howa or Norinco firearm from Interarms, delay no longer. These two lines will not be in the 1995 Interarms line-up.
Ithaca Gun
The Model 87 pump-action shotgun is still the mainstay of Ithaca Gun. The versions range from the Supreme with its hand checkering to the no-nonsense Camo Field that is camouflaged entirely with Ithaca's own Camoseal pattern. There are also the Model 87 Protection Guns that are used by big-city police and are ideal for home protection. Most 87s are available in both 12- and 20-gauge and they all have 3-inch chambers.
Ithaca is also offering a .50 caliber target rifle that is made by American Arms & Ordnance. The bolt-action rifle is available in single-shot and five-round magazine models. The rifle has established a top reputation in 1,000-yard target competitions.
